I can't choose just one -- World Showcase is my favorite part of WDW! Japan has great landscaping, food, music and shopping; France has an awesome movie, great food, the patisserie and my favorite French wines. Germany has the model railroad and the Biergarten with it's fun atmosphere. You get the idea... they all have something appealing.
